Holistic wellbeing
WELL certification serves as a third-party quality label for the comfort and wellbeing of facilities. The International WELL Building Institute (IWBI) issues certificates for facilities or properties if the required criteria are met. Certification provides a clear framework for wellbeing and ways in which it can be promoted among facility users. The aim is to create good conditions for both productivity and creativity in the premises. The certification is based on studies that have examined how the environment affects people.
With WELL certification, the comfort of the premises is measured through various criteria using 10 different areas, such as indoor air and acoustics. The technical characteristics of the facilities are assessed, but in addition, the organisation’s activities from the point of view of wellbeing and its promotion are also taken into account. The facilities encourage a healthy and balanced lifestyle, for example during the working day. In its simplest form, the development of facilities can be seen for example by adding plants or communicating and encouraging a healthier diet.
The WELL certificate takes into account the following 10 areas:
- High-quality indoor air
- Clean drinking water and hygienic use of water
- Healthy diet
- High-quality and functional lighting and utilization of natural light
- Exercise and promotion of physical activity
- Thermal comfort, suitably pleasant and even temperature
- Pleasant acoustics
- Safe and healthy materials for indoor air
- Spatial solutions and operating models that support wellbeing
- Spatial solutions and operating models that encourage cooperation
